Polycarbonate's inherent strength provides superior impact resistance, crucial for protecting hydraulic components and preventing catastrophic failure due to external forces or pressure surges. Its excellent optical clarity allows for direct visual inspection of fluid levels and flow within enclosed hydraulic systems. This material exhibits good chemical resistance to common hydraulic fluids, ensuring longevity and preventing degradation under operational stress, making it an ideal choice for sight glasses, protective guards, and fluid containment in hydraulic machinery.

| ❌ Mistake | ✅ Correct Approach |
|---|---|
| Using abrasive cleaners or solvents that can scratch or degrade the polycarbonate surface. | Clean with mild soap and water, or a specialized polycarbonate cleaner. Avoid harsh chemicals. |
| Over-tightening fasteners, leading to localized stress concentrations and potential cracking. | Utilize washers and torque fasteners to a manufacturer-recommended level, ensuring even pressure distribution. |
